GREATER PHILADELPHIA FILM OFFICE
"A “film commission” representing southeastern Pennsylvania that officially serves the counties of Bucks, Chester, Delaware, Montgomery, and Philadelphia. We are a member of the Association of Film Commissions International (AFCI), and a founding member of Film US. GPFO, first established in 1985 as a part of Philadelphia city government, continues to reside within city offices. In 1992, we became a regional economic development office, incorporating as the Greater Philadelphia Film Office, a Pennsylvania non profit corporation, in July, 2000."
LIBRIVOX
"LibriVox volunteers record chapters of books in the public domain and release the audio files back onto the net. Our goal is to make all public domain books available as free audio books. We are a totally volunteer, open source, free content, public domain project."
THEATER ALLIANCE OF GREATER PHILADELPHIA
"The Theatre Alliance of Greater Philadelphia is a member-based service and leadership organization composed of non-profit professional theatres, individuals, and other affiliated organizations within the Greater Philadelphia region. The Theatre Alliance serves to strengthen and lead the region's richly diverse theatre community by promoting positive awareness and serving as a resource for information, professional development and advocacy."
